Some effective strategies for solving keyword search problems in information retrieval systems include using Boolean operators (AND, OR, NOT), refining search terms with synonyms or related terms, using quotation marks for exact phrases, and utilizing advanced search filters and operators provided by the search engine. Additionally, understanding the context of the search and using specific keywords related to the topic can improve search results.

The least constraining value heuristic is important in constraint satisfaction problems because it helps to prioritize values that have the least impact on limiting future choices. By selecting values that impose the fewest constraints on other variables, this heuristic can lead to more efficient and effective problem-solving strategies.
